Enter recipient details
After selecting the destination country, the next step in the process is to provide the recipient’s information. This is a crucial part of the transfer, as accurate details ensure that the money reaches the right person and is delivered through the chosen method.
You will need to provide the recipient’s full name as it appears on their identification documents. Additionally, you will select how the recipient will receive the funds. Western Union offers several delivery options, including:
- Cash Pickup: The recipient can pick up the funds in cash at one of Western Union’s agent locations in the destination country. You will need to specify the recipient’s location or city, and the recipient must present a valid ID and the tracking number (MTCN) to collect the money.
- Bank Deposit: If the recipient prefers to receive the funds directly into their bank account, you’ll need to provide the recipient’s bank account details, such as the bank name, account number, and any other relevant banking information required for the transaction.
- Mobile Wallet: For recipients using mobile wallet services, such as a mobile money account, you’ll need to provide the recipient’s mobile number or wallet ID, depending on the specific service available in the recipient’s country.
Make sure the recipient’s details are accurate and complete to ensure a smooth transfer. Any errors could delay the transaction or cause issues when the recipient attempts to collect the money. Once you’ve entered the recipient’s information and chosen the delivery method, you’ll proceed to the next step, which is confirming the transfer details and making the payment.
Choose payment method
Once you’ve entered the recipient’s details and chosen the delivery method, the next step is to decide how you will pay for the transfer. Western Union offers several payment options, giving you flexibility depending on what’s most convenient for you. The available payment methods may vary depending on your country, but generally, you can choose from the following:
- Credit or Debit Cards: Using a credit or debit card is one of the fastest and most straightforward ways to pay for a transfer. Simply enter your card details during the checkout process, and the payment will be processed immediately. This option is ideal for those who need to send money quickly.
- Bank Account: If you prefer to pay directly from your bank account, you can link your account to your Western Union profile. Bank transfers usually take longer than card payments, but they can be a more cost-effective option, especially for larger amounts. You’ll need to provide your bank details and authorize the transfer.
- Other Payment Methods: Depending on your location, Western Union may also offer additional payment methods, such as online banking, e-wallets, or payment services like PayPal. These options can vary by country, so it’s worth checking what is available to you.
After selecting your preferred payment method, review the transaction details, including the transfer fees, exchange rates, and estimated delivery time. Make sure everything is correct before proceeding to finalize the payment. Once the payment is completed, you’ll receive a confirmation along with a tracking number (MTCN) that you can use to track the transfer and share with the recipient for cash pickup or verification.

Cash pickup
One of the most common ways to receive money through Western Union is via cash pickup. This method allows recipients to collect their funds in person at any Western Union agent location. Here’s what you need to do:
Find an agent location
Use the Western Union website or app to locate a nearby agent.
Bring identification
Visit the agent location with a valid ID and the tracking number (MTCN) provided by the sender.
Collect your money
The agent will verify your details and hand over the cash. It’s a simple and straightforward process.
Cash pickup is widely used in countries like Pakistan, India, and Cameroon, providing a reliable way for recipients to get their money quickly.
Bank deposit
Another popular method for receiving money is directly into a bank account. This method is convenient for those who prefer not to handle cash. Here’s how it works:
Provide bank details
The sender needs to enter your bank account information when initiating the transfer.
Wait for the deposit
Once the transfer is processed, the funds will be deposited directly into your bank account. This usually takes a few minutes to a few hours, depending on the destination country.
Confirmation
You’ll receive a notification from your bank once the money is deposited.
Bank deposits are common in India and the United States, offering a seamless and secure way to receive funds without visiting an agent location.

Tracking transfers
Western Union provides several tools and features to track the status of your money transfers in real-time. This ensures transparency and gives both the sender and recipient peace of mind. Here’s how you can track your transfer:
Tracking number (MTCN)
Every Western Union transfer is assigned a unique tracking number known as the Money Transfer Control Number (MTCN). You can use this number to check the status of your transfer.
Online tracking
Visit the Western Union website or app, enter the MTCN, and get real-time updates on your transfer status.
Notifications
Opt-in for email or SMS notifications to receive updates on your transfer status, including when the money is ready for pickup or deposited into the recipient’s account.
Tracking transfers is crucial for ensuring the safety and reliability of your transactions, especially in regions like Pakistan, India, and Cameroon.
Security and fraud prevention
Security is a top priority for Western Union. The company employs various measures to ensure that your money transfers are secure and to prevent fraud. Here are some of the key security features:
Encryption
Western Union uses advanced encryption technology to protect your personal and financial information during transactions.
Verification processes
Rigorous verification processes are in place to confirm the identity of senders and recipients, reducing the risk of fraud.
24/7 monitoring
Western Union’s systems are continuously monitored for suspicious activity, enabling the company to detect and prevent fraudulent transactions in real-time.
Customer alerts
Customers are alerted to potential scams and advised on best practices to avoid fraud, such as not sharing personal information with strangers and verifying the legitimacy of the transaction.
By prioritizing security, Western Union ensures that your money reaches its intended destination safely, whether you’re sending or receiving funds in India, the United States, or anywhere else in the world.
